The latest crypto rally is pushing further into the market's most speculative corner. Dog and cat tokens are part of that now, with several memecoins jumping sharply in a short time as traders clearly take on more risk.
Cash Cat Leads the Move
Cash Cat, a cat-themed memecoin on Robinhood Chain, jumped about 51% on Tuesday in 24 hours to $0.218 (€0.19). Over the past week, the token is up more than 113%, and over 30 days the price has climbed about 345%. That brought its market value to around $215 million (€184 million).
Other cat tokens joined in too. Thinking Cat rose 131% in seven days, Purr gained 93%, Popcat climbed 54%, and cat in a dogs world, or MEW, went up 49%. That fits the pattern that smaller tokens often move harder when interest in risky crypto picks up.
Dog Coins Are Rising Too
The same pattern is visible in dog coins. Dog (Bitcoin) has nearly doubled in a week, while dogwifhat rose 64%, Bonk gained 47%, and Floki was up 40%. Even the biggest memecoins joined the move, though the swings there were smaller: Dogecoin rose about 32% in seven days and Shiba Inu about 30%.
Memecoins are crypto that mainly revolve around internet jokes or communities, not a traditional business model or cash flow. That is exactly why they often react sharply when the market is more willing to take risk. With smaller tokens, thin liquidity can make price moves even bigger, both up and down.
For anyone following the bigger memecoins, it is worth noting that Dogecoin and Shiba Inu had previously fallen to their lowest combined market value in three years. That shows how quickly capital can shift between memecoins and larger cryptocurrencies.
Why This Matters
For European crypto followers, this rally shows how fast sentiment can swing toward the edges of the market. The Crypto Fear & Greed Index is currently around 75, according to the latest reading, the highest level since early October 2025, after sitting around 30 about a week earlier. That points to clearly stronger optimism, although a sentiment gauge like this says nothing about where prices will go in the short term.
